As a food connoisseur, my favorite thing to do in any city is to find good restaurants, whether they’re an upscale hot spot or a low-key mom-and-pop dive. As you can imagine, Nashville has an incredible food scene and locals love their Meat-and-Three and Hot Chicken. Meat-and-Three features a choice of one meat (beef, chicken, pork, fried fish) and three sides or vegetables. One of the best restaurants in the city to enjoy this popular menu item is Edley’s BBQ.
Nashville “hot chicken” is exactly how it sounds; hot, spicy, fried chicken that is prepared with a few different “heat” options. Arguably the most popular fast casual hot chicken place in Nashville is Hattie B’s where they have 6 different heat levels ranging from Southern (no heat) to Shut the Cluck Up!!! (burn notice). I stuck with their Mild (touch of heat) option because, well, I like to enjoy my meal without my mouth being on fire. Not only was Hattie B’s hot chicken tender, tasty, and delicious, but the vibe inside was right up my alley with a mix of new and old school hip hop being played in the background. The line was out the door when we arrived and left, so I was convinced that this was the best choice to experience Nashville’s hot chicken.

Probably my favorite upscale dining experience during my trip was a sneak peek and an exclusive tasting at Mimo located in Nashville’s brand new and soon to open Four Seasons. Executive Chef Aniello "Nello" Turco wowed us with his elevated Southern Italian dishes fused with local Southern influences. Chef Turco has a Michelin-starred background having worked at outposts such as Noma in Copenhagen and Mio in Beijing. Nashville locals should be very excited for the opening of this new restaurant.
